Understanding the Early Warning Signs of A/C Issues

When residents detect odd changes in their AC systems, it often signals the need for repair. Frequent early symptoms consist of inconsistent cooling, where particular spaces remain warmer than expected, or the system fails to keep up with the programmed temperature. Strange noises, such as grinding or hissing, can point to mechanical problems or refrigerant leaks. Moreover, an unanticipated spike in utility bills may imply that the system is exerting extra effort to maintain comfort, often due to operational inefficiencies. Residents should remain watchful for unusual odors, particularly mildew-like or burning odors, which could signal electrical faults or mold buildup. Finally, if the AC unit constantly switches on and off, this may suggest a defective thermostat or other underlying concerns. Recognizing these signs early can help prevent more extensive damage and costly repairs.

How to Repair Your A/C When It's Producing Warm Air

When an AC unit begins producing warm air, some essential inspections can typically fix the situation. Initially, confirming the thermostat settings validates that the system is properly set to cooling mode. Furthermore, evaluating the air filters and assessing the refrigerant levels can aid in detecting typical problems that may compromise maximum efficiency.

Check Thermostat Settings

What steps can one take to ensure their air conditioning system is functioning at its best? A crucial starting point includes checking the thermostat settings. In many cases, warm air problems stem from incorrect thermostat configurations. Making sure the thermostat is configured to the preferred cooling temperature is essential. For programmable thermostats, checking the schedule for possible overrides or conflicts is also beneficial. It is also vital to check that the thermostat is properly set to "cool" mode, given that it might accidentally be switched to "heat" or "off". Should the settings seem accurate yet the issue continues, recalibrating the thermostat or changing its batteries may be required. Performing these straightforward checks can commonly help reestablish the ideal comfort level throughout the home.

Check Air Filters

Inspecting air filters is crucial for preserving peak air conditioning efficiency. Obstructed or soiled filters can limit airflow, causing the system to operate less efficiently and potentially leading to excessive heat buildup. This inefficiency often results in hot air flowing from vents, suggesting a need for immediate attention. Homeowners should check filters monthly, especially during heavy usage seasons. If filters seem grimy or discolored, replacing them is a simple solution that can return the system to full efficiency. Typically, filters should be changed every one to three-month period, depending on usage and environmental factors. Regular maintenance of air filters not only enhances cooling efficiency but also promotes cleaner indoor air, creating a healthier home atmosphere. Prompt examinations can help avert costly repairs later on.

Assess Refrigerant Gas Levels

A low refrigerant level can significantly affect the cooling effectiveness of an air conditioning system. When the refrigerant is insufficient, the system struggles to absorb heat, causing warm air to blow from the vents. Homeowners are advised to periodically inspect refrigerant levels as part of their regular maintenance schedule. If a reduction in cooling capacity is detected, this could signal a refrigerant leak or depletion. To resolve this problem, a qualified technician should be contacted to assess the system. They can identify leaks and recharge the refrigerant to the manufacturer's specifications. Ignoring refrigerant concerns can result in more serious complications, among them compressor damage. Prompt inspection of refrigerant levels ensures optimal performance and prolongs the lifespan of the air conditioning unit.

What Different Noises From Your A/C Mean

When an air conditioner produces strange sounds, it often signals underlying issues that require attention. Buzzing noises are often a sign of electrical faults, while hissing noises can point to refrigerant leaks. Furthermore, clanging sounds generally indicate loose or broken parts inside the unit.

Buzzing Sounds Indicate Issues

Buzzing noises coming from an air conditioning unit frequently indicate hidden problems that need to be addressed. These sounds can indicate numerous potential issues, including electrical complications, loose components, or malfunctioning motors. When the system experiences operational difficulties, it may produce a persistent buzzing, suggesting that the electrical connections might be compromised or that buildup is hindering the fan's operation. Moreover, buzzing may indicate a defective capacitor, which plays a vital role in the compressor's function. Ignoring these noises can lead to more significant damage and costly repairs. Homeowners should not dismiss these warning signs and should seek expert assistance to identify and resolve the problem quickly, ensuring the continued efficiency and longevity of their air conditioning system.

Hissing Sound Warning Indicators

Many homeowners could notice hissing noises emanating from their air conditioning systems, which can point to certain problems that need attention. A hissing noise often suggests a refrigerant leakage, where the refrigerant seeps through small gaps or cracks in the cooling system. This not only impacts the cooling efficiency but can also damage the environment. In addition, hissing can result from a clogged or malfunctioning expansion valve, which manages refrigerant circulation. If the noise comes with inconsistent temperatures or reduced cooling performance, it signals further complications. Homeowners are advised to address these sounds immediately, as overlooking them can lead to more extensive repairs or total system breakdown. Identifying these warning signs is vital for keeping an efficient and effective air conditioning system.

Clanging Signals Loose Parts

Clanging noises from an air conditioning unit commonly suggest loose or damaged parts that demand urgent assessment. These sounds may originate from a variety of sources within the system. For example, unsecured fasteners or bolts may allow internal parts to vibrate, while a defective fan blade may collide with the housing, producing a banging sound. Additionally, complications involving the compressor or ventilation channels can also amplify these bothersome disturbances. Ignoring these sounds can lead to more significant problems, including decreased functionality or full system collapse. Property owners ought to reach out to a skilled specialist to assess and correct any contributing factors quickly. Prompt attention can eliminate unnecessary expenses and confirm the air conditioning unit performs consistently and effectively.

How Unusual Smells Signal A/C Repair Requirements

In what ways can unusual smells indicate the need for air conditioning repair? Foul odors coming from an air conditioning unit frequently suggest underlying problems that demand prompt attention. A damp, musty smell could indicate mold or mildew development inside the unit, which may compromise indoor air quality. Such problems can result from obstructed condensate drains or poor airflow circulation.

A acrid odor could suggest electrical problems or overheating components, which could pose a serious fire risk. Conversely, a chemical or sugary smell might suggest a refrigerant leak, necessitating prompt repair to stop further deterioration and preserve efficient functionality.

Acknowledging these odors and understanding their significance is essential for residents. Neglecting such indicators can lead to costly repairs and decreased system effectiveness. Therefore, tackling unexpected scents quickly can preserve both the air conditioning unit and the well-being of its inhabitants.

Are Your Energy Bills Higher Because of Your A/C?

Have energy bills been climbing unexpectedly even with consistent A/C use? This situation may indicate underlying issues with the air conditioning unit. An outdated or neglected system can find it challenging to cool a home properly, resulting in higher energy usage. Elements such as dirty filters, refrigerant leaks, or defective thermostats can considerably hinder performance, forcing the unit to operate beyond its optimal capacity.

Moreover, inadequate insulation or air leaks within the home can intensify this problem, causing cooled air to seep out and compelling the A/C to operate for extended periods. Homeowners should monitor their energy bills closely to identify trends that signal potential inefficiencies. If energy costs persist in climbing without a straightforward cause, it might be time to think about arranging an inspection or servicing of the air conditioning system. Tackling these problems in a timely manner can help recover system efficiency and possibly lower those escalating energy costs.

Common Questions and Answers

How Often Should I Schedule A/C Maintenance?

Specialists suggest scheduling air conditioning maintenance no less than one time per year, ideally before the cooling season begins. Routine inspections ensure optimal performance, extend the unit's lifespan, and prevent unexpected breakdowns during peak usage.

Can I Fix My A/C on My Own?

He can attempt minor repairs if properly skilled, but advanced malfunctions typically necessitate specialized skills. Potential hazards and the risk of voiding warranties make consulting an expert advisable for significant malfunctions to guarantee efficient and safe operation.

What Are the Advantages of Upgrading My A/C System?

Replacing your AC system improves energy performance, cuts down on utility bills, upgrades air quality inside your home, increases your home's market value, and provides better air conditioning performance. All of these advantages lead to a better and more enjoyable living space.

How Long Should My A/C Unit Last?

A central air conditioning system typically lasts 15 to 20 years, based on how it is used, serviced, and the quality of the model. Routine maintenance can extend its lifespan, while insufficient maintenance may lead to unexpected breakdowns and a decline in efficiency.

What Temperature Should I Set My Air Conditioner for Maximum Efficiency?

For optimal performance, configuring the air conditioner between 72°F and 78°F is suggested. This span optimizes both comfort and energy efficiency, permitting the system to run at peak performance while minimizing electricity costs throughout the cooling season.
